Tourmaline’s Practical Role Amid Modern Industries

Oddly enough, tourmaline isn’t just prized for its natural beauty or its use in adornments. It’s the electrical and piezoelectric properties of the crystal that make it an industrial darling. Many engineers swear by it for electronic insulation and intricate sensor designs. You see, tourmaline generates an electric charge when stressed—this piezoelectric trait isn’t just a neat party trick in labs; it’s a real-world workhorse for things like pressure gauges, high-precision instruments, and even energy harvesting tech.

Over the years, I’ve noticed a trend where tourmaline crystals show up in devices that need to convert mechanical energy into electrical signals, and vice versa. It’s like a classic hydraulic jack in mechanical engineering—but for electrons. This makes it invaluable in medical ultrasound transducers, vibration sensors, and even wearable health tech that taps into bio-electric feedback.

Industrial Applications and Advantages of Tourmaline

So, why bother with tourmaline at all instead of man-made materials? For one, the durability and stability under high temperatures and rough conditions are something synthetic materials still struggle to match. Its naturally occurring negative ions also explain why it’s popular in health-related manufacturing, from ionic hairdryers to air purifiers. It sounds a little woo-woo until you realize this ion emission actually helps reduce dust and allergens in enclosed spaces—a small but tangible edge in industrial HVAC systems.

Customization is another highlight. Producers can tweak the size, shape, purity, and electrical orientation of the crystals to tailor them to specific needs. I remember a client needing a piezoelectric sensor for a harsh chemical environment—tourmaline’s chemical resistance sealed the deal there.
